What is Hard Water?

Hard water contains high levels of minerals, primarily calcium and magnesium. These minerals accumulate over time, leading to a range of issues that can significantly affect both plumbing systems and appliances.

Common Signs of Hard Water

  • Scale Buildup: White, chalky deposits on faucets and fixtures.
  • Reduced Water Flow: Clogged pipes leading to decreased water pressure.
  • Soap Scum: Difficulty lathering soap and residue left on dishes and skin.

How Hard Water Affects Plumbing Systems

1. Scale Buildup in Pipes

Over time, hard water can lead to the formation of mineral deposits inside pipes, causing narrowing and blockages. This scale buildup can lead to increased pressure on your plumbing system, resulting in leaks and pipe failures.

2. Decreased Appliance Efficiency

Appliances such as water heaters, dishwashers, and washing machines may work harder due to mineral buildup, resulting in reduced efficiency and higher energy bills. In the High Desert, where many rely on these appliances, the impact can be significant.

3. Shortened Lifespan of Plumbing Fixtures

Faucets, showerheads, and water heaters are prone to wear and tear caused by hard water. Mineral deposits can corrode and damage these fixtures, leading to premature replacements and increased maintenance costs.

Solutions for Hard Water in the High Desert

Water Softener Systems

Installing a water softener is one of the best ways to mitigate the effects of hard water. A water softener works by removing hard minerals and providing you with softened water for your home.
